Welcome to Main Kitchen Cafe, a hidden gem nestled in Canoga Park, CA. Located at 8901 De Soto Ave, this delightful eatery promises a culinary experience that blends southern comfort with Mexican flair, all served with a touch of warmth and hospitality.
As you step inside, the vibe is immediately inviting. From the friendly staff to the charming decor, you feel right at home. “ This was our first time coming here for breakfast. We will be coming here frequently! The food was amazing, the staf is knowledgeable and attentive and we met Monica the owner. Monica is very nice and gracious. It is obvious that she takes pride in her restaurant, it comes through in the warm, cozy atmosphere and the delicious food. Here is what we ordered- Bacon, ham, turkey and Swiss cheese omelet and breakfast potatoes. The turkey and ham were real, not cold cuts. The bacon was cooked to perfection. Honey butter fried chicken and pancakes. The 2 pieces of chicken were boneless chicken breasts that were well seasoned and delicious. The 2 pancakes were large and really had a good taste. Chicken fried steak and biscuits, so good! The gravy was yummy, the biscuits were lights and fluffy and the steak was well seasoned and delicious. Also on the plate were 2 eggs any style and breakfast potatoes. The Brunch Burger with crosscut fries. This burger consisted of a beef patty, fried egg, tomato, onion, sauce and cheddar cheese.
